Scarce, Low Mintage 1894 Morgan Dollar MS62
1894 $1 MS62 ANACS. The 1894 Morgan dollar may not be immediately thought of as an important key date in the series, but perhaps it should be. It is certainly a key date among the Philadelphia Mint issues; with the lowest Morgan dollar mintage ever seen at that facility. This example is well struck and lustrous, with attractive light peripheral patina and minor marks for the grade. Perhaps even a candidate for a one-point upgrade.From The Mario Eller Collection.(Registry values: P8, N1793)
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 255V, PCGS# 7228, GSID# 7578)
Metal: 90% Silver, 10% Copper
Weight: 26.73 grams
ASW: 0.77346oz
Mintage: 110,972
